+#include <linux/uaccess.h>
+#include <linux/sprd_mm.h>
+#include <video/sprd_isp.h>
+#include "isp_reg.h"
+
+#define ISP_AFM_WIN_NUM_V1 25
+
+static int32_t isp_k_yiq_afm_block(struct isp_io_param *param)
+{
+ int32_t ret = 0;
+ uint32_t val = 0;
+ uint32_t i = 0;
+ int max_num = ISP_AFM_WIN_NUM_V1;
+ struct isp_dev_yiq_afm_info_v2 afm_info;
+
+ memset(&afm_info, 0x00, sizeof(afm_info));
+
+ ret = copy_from_user((void *)&afm_info, param->property_param, sizeof(afm_info));
+ if (0 != ret) {
+ printk("isp_k_yiq_afm_block: copy error, ret=0x%x\n", (uint32_t)ret);
+ return -1;
+ }
+
+ REG_MWR(ISP_YIQ_AFM_PARAM, BIT_6, afm_info.mode << 6);
+
+ REG_MWR(ISP_YIQ_AFM_PARAM, 0x1F<<1, (afm_info.shift << 1));
+
+ REG_MWR(ISP_YIQ_AFM_PARAM, 0xF<<7, (afm_info.skip_num << 7));
+
+ REG_MWR(ISP_YIQ_AFM_PARAM, BIT_11, afm_info.skip_num_clear << 11);
+
+ REG_MWR(ISP_YIQ_AFM_PARAM, BIT_12, afm_info.af_position << 12);
+
+ REG_MWR(ISP_YIQ_AFM_PARAM, 0x7<<13, (afm_info.format << 13));
+
+ REG_MWR(ISP_YIQ_AFM_PARAM, BIT_16, afm_info.iir_bypass << 16);
+
+ for (i = 0; i < max_num; i++) {
+ val = ((afm_info.coord[i].start_y <<16) & 0xffff0000)
+ | (afm_info.coord[i].start_x & 0xffff);
+ REG_WR((ISP_YIQ_AFM_WIN_RANGE0 + 4*2*i), val);
+
+ val = ((afm_info.coord[i].end_y <<16) & 0xffff0000)
+ | (afm_info.coord[i].end_x & 0xffff);
+ REG_WR((ISP_YIQ_AFM_WIN_RANGE0 + 4*(2*i+1)), val);
+ }
+
+ for (i = 0; i < 10; i+= 2) {
+ val = (afm_info.IIR_c[i] & 0xFFF) | ((afm_info.IIR_c[i + 1] & 0xFFF) << 16);
+ REG_WR(ISP_YIQ_AFM_COEF0_1 + (i / 2) * 4, val);
+ }
+ val = afm_info.IIR_c[10] & 0xFFF;
+ REG_WR(ISP_YIQ_AFM_COEF10, val);
+
+ REG_MWR(ISP_YIQ_AFM_PARAM, BIT_0, afm_info.bypass);
+
+ return ret;
+
+}
+
+static int32_t isp_k_yiq_afm_slice_size(struct isp_io_param *param)
+{
+ int32_t ret = 0;
+ uint32_t val = 0;
+ struct isp_img_size slice_size= {0, 0};
+
+ ret = copy_from_user((void *)&slice_size, param->property_param, sizeof(slice_size));
+ if (0 != ret) {
+ printk("isp_k_ae_skip_num: copy_from_user error, ret = 0x%x\n", (uint32_t)ret);
+ return -1;
+ }
+
+ val = (slice_size.width& 0xFFFF) | ((slice_size.height& 0xFFFF) << 16);
+ REG_WR( ISP_YIQ_AFM_SLICE_SIZE, val);
+
+
+ return ret;
+}
+
+int32_t isp_k_cfg_yiq_afm(struct isp_io_param *param)
+{
+ int32_t ret = 0;
+
+ if (!param) {
+ printk("isp_k_cfg_afm: param is null error.\n");
+ return -1;
+ }
+
+ if (NULL == param->property_param) {
+ printk("isp_k_cfg_afm: property_param is null error.\n");
+ return -1;
+ }
+
+ switch (param->property) {
+ case ISP_PRO_YIQ_AFM_BLOCK:
+ ret = isp_k_yiq_afm_block(param);
+ break;
+ case ISP_PRO_YIQ_AFM_SLICE_SIZE:
+ ret = isp_k_yiq_afm_slice_size(param);
+ break;
+ default:
+ printk("isp_k_cfg_yiq_afm: fail cmd id:%d, not supported.\n", param->property);
+ break;
+ }
+
+ return ret;
+}
